Indian cricket captain Rahul Dravid and left-arm pacer Irfan Pathan are the only Indians in the latest International Cricket Council (ICC) one-day international (ODI) top 10 player rankings.

Dravid slipped two places to ninth in the batting ratings while his deputy Virender Sehwag lies at 19th. Sachin Tendulkar occupies the 21st spot followed closely by wicketkeeper-batsman Mahendra Singh Dhoni in 23rd.
Australian captain Ricky Ponting is atop the batsman's list while countryman Adam Gilchrist is second. South African captain Graeme Smith is in the third spot.
In the one-day bowlers ratings, Pathan shares seventh spot with Sri Lanka's Chaminda Vaas. The only other Indian in the top 20 is Harbhajan Singh, who occupies the 11th spot.
Australia's Glenn McGrath is on top of the bowling list followed by compatriot Brett Lee. South Africa's Shaun Pollock is in third to complete the Australia-Australia-South Africa podium in both the batting and bowlers lists.
